Output 782561b61d8206c31ab45f939b1e037c9614b0f45f1a5772be5170a1abdf2f60:1

value
2358105480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34ed8c5ffdcdbdbd45cec94a17e31c4bcb7a38ec OP_EQUAL
address
36WsdfdpQ4Hh79WTmPyb13uJ7K8wnC69Wv
transaction
782561b61d8206c31ab45f939b1e037c9614b0f45f1a5772be5170a1abdf2f60
spent
true